Air New Zealand to phase out three dry-leased Boeing 777s by 2028

Air New Zealand plans to remove three dry-leased Boeing 777s from its fleet by 2028, outlining a future reduction in leased widebody capacity. The announcement provides a defined timeline for the airline’s fleet transition and for the affected aircraft’s lessors and operators.

Syrian Airlines expands fleet with A320 acquisitions

By FlightGlobal: Flag-carrier introducing additional narrowbodies as it continues post-Assad recovery. Syrian Airlines is acquiring a pair of Airbus A320s as it continues its recovery following the fall of the Bashar Al-Assad government.
